summaryrefslogtreecommitdiffstats
path: root/src/com/android/launcher3/compat/AppWidgetManagerCompatVL.java
diff options
context:
space:
mode:
authorSunny Goyal <sunnygoyal@google.com>2016-12-15 15:53:17 -0800
committerSunny Goyal <sunnygoyal@google.com>2016-12-15 22:06:10 -0800
commit7c74e4ae641e76f73d74348e293c244a157f6585 (patch)
tree52f84297787842137b3bd1818bc0d5f723d1e3ab /src/com/android/launcher3/compat/AppWidgetManagerCompatVL.java
parent338dee9dd7a7b087bf182f16970c16ffd940b435 (diff)
downloadandroid_packages_apps_Trebuchet-7c74e4ae641e76f73d74348e293c244a157f6585.tar.gz
android_packages_apps_Trebuchet-7c74e4ae641e76f73d74348e293c244a157f6585.tar.bz2
android_packages_apps_Trebuchet-7c74e4ae641e76f73d74348e293c244a157f6585.zip
No more UserHandleCompat
Bug: 32745285 Change-Id: I762fb4e268c1afe48a1860ab12a4ccb3f626aa95
Diffstat (limited to 'src/com/android/launcher3/compat/AppWidgetManagerCompatVL.java')
-rw-r--r--src/com/android/launcher3/compat/AppWidgetManagerCompatVL.java14
1 files changed, 7 insertions, 7 deletions
diff --git a/src/com/android/launcher3/compat/AppWidgetManagerCompatVL.java b/src/com/android/launcher3/compat/AppWidgetManagerCompatVL.java
index a1570e66a..0acf75373 100644
--- a/src/com/android/launcher3/compat/AppWidgetManagerCompatVL.java
+++ b/src/com/android/launcher3/compat/AppWidgetManagerCompatVL.java
@@ -33,6 +33,7 @@ import android.graphics.drawable.BitmapDrawable;
import android.graphics.drawable.Drawable;
import android.os.Build;
import android.os.Bundle;
+import android.os.Process;
import android.os.UserHandle;
import android.os.UserManager;
import android.view.View;
@@ -81,11 +82,11 @@ class AppWidgetManagerCompatVL extends AppWidgetManagerCompat {
}
@Override
- public UserHandleCompat getUser(LauncherAppWidgetProviderInfo info) {
+ public UserHandle getUser(LauncherAppWidgetProviderInfo info) {
if (info.isCustomWidget) {
- return UserHandleCompat.myUserHandle();
+ return Process.myUserHandle();
}
- return UserHandleCompat.fromUser(info.getProfile());
+ return info.getProfile();
}
@Override
@@ -150,9 +151,9 @@ class AppWidgetManagerCompatVL extends AppWidgetManagerCompat {
}
@Override
- public LauncherAppWidgetProviderInfo findProvider(ComponentName provider, UserHandleCompat user) {
+ public LauncherAppWidgetProviderInfo findProvider(ComponentName provider, UserHandle user) {
for (AppWidgetProviderInfo info : mAppWidgetManager
- .getInstalledProvidersForProfile(user.getUser())) {
+ .getInstalledProvidersForProfile(user)) {
if (info.provider.equals(provider)) {
return LauncherAppWidgetProviderInfo.fromProviderInfo(mContext, info);
}
@@ -164,10 +165,9 @@ class AppWidgetManagerCompatVL extends AppWidgetManagerCompat {
public HashMap<ComponentKey, AppWidgetProviderInfo> getAllProvidersMap() {
HashMap<ComponentKey, AppWidgetProviderInfo> result = new HashMap<>();
for (UserHandle user : mUserManager.getUserProfiles()) {
- UserHandleCompat userHandle = UserHandleCompat.fromUser(user);
for (AppWidgetProviderInfo info :
mAppWidgetManager.getInstalledProvidersForProfile(user)) {
- result.put(new ComponentKey(info.provider, userHandle), info);
+ result.put(new ComponentKey(info.provider, user), info);
}
}
return result;